During the month, the British public was wearing a red paper flowers are known as Poppy in their chests, as an expression of their appreciation to the hero.<br />

Broadcast television, politicians, educators, young executives, artists, soccer players and the general public a poppy pinned on their chests. Interest they earn on the street in shopping area by entering a number of donations to the red tube.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The volunteers, not just the teens and students and members of veterans who joined the Royal British Legion, as well as mothers carrying boxes of paper poppies with donation boxes.</p>
<p>This year, exactly 9 November 2008, the Royal British Legion, a charity organization for the British Legion Veterans of war, commemorating the day that the British hero-90.</p>

<p>Commemorations conducted every second week of November was known as &#8220;Rembrance Sunday&#8221;. Veterans wearing decorations they have followed a wreath laying ceremony at the memorial.<br />
In addition, promptly at 11 am, in many of the UK, held a silence for two minutes, which not only followed the veterans, but also students, as Heroes&#8217; Day on 10 November in the homeland.</p>
<p>In London, the show of silence &#8220;Silence in the Square&#8221; plaza square centered in the city of London Trafalgar Square, where the statue stood firm Neilson, headed by the Duke of Edinburgh.</p>
<p>During the month of November, the Royal British Legion to do fundraising to support the living veterans and their families, by providing a poppy for the contributors.</p>
<p>Poppy flowers become a symbol of remembering the heroes of the British services were pinned red flowers made of paper on his collar.<br />
Poppy flowers that statement as the delivery of respect and gratitude to those who have sacrificed themselves in war.</p>
<p>British Queen, Elizabeth, each year following the memorial service Sunday &#8220; Remember that was held at Cenotaph, White Hall, London, along with members of the royal family, ministers and officials as well as British citizens who have been involved in the war.</p>

<p>Heroes of Iraq and Afghanistan</p>
<p>Memorial day hero or the so-called `Remember` Suday, also held in various cities in the United Kingdom, not only to think back to the soldiers who died in the first world war and second, but also those who perished in the conflict in Iraq and in Afghanistan .</p>
<p>Director of Communications Royal British Legion, Stuart Gendall, said this year marks the 90th year commemoration of the end of the first World War in which many young people who had sacrificed his life for the country.</p>
<p>This is also reflected in the sacrifice of young children who die on the battlefield today both in Afghanistan and in Iraq. &#8220;I think the warning silence for two minutes is still relevant today,&#8221; he said.</p>
<p>For that, Stuart invited all citizens to follow the meditation ceremony, and joined with members of veterans to commemorate the heroes of services UK services.</p>
<p>According to Gendall, from the field after the World War, many veterans were injured or lost a job, so much suffering or difficulties both physically and mentally.</p>
<p>Many of them formed various groups to help each other, which eventually formed the legions of British veterans of this, in 1921.</p>
<p>From the sale of poppies and wreaths and crosses for each year anniversary, the British Legion managed to get nearly 26 million Pounds Sterling.</p>
<p>Support the cost of living</p>
<p>He said last year, as many as 75 million Pounsterling Royal British Legion used to support the cost of living veterans. The organization now has around 500 thousand people.</p>
<p>Not only that. As a charity, they also support the war veterans across the UK of more than 10 million people.</p>
<p>Many of those who suffer from this mentally ill or various other diseases, with inadequate income.</p>
<p>In addition to providing housing for elderly veterans, the British Legion to help those who were young enough to get a job like making the poppies. Each year, the British Legion takes about 36 million poppies.</p>
<p>Basically a poppy is a symbol that is known internationally, as a warning to those who have sacrificed themselves in battle.</p>
<p>Bill Kay, manager of a poppy manufacturers only in English, explaining the relationship between artificial poppy flowers with memorial day hero in the UK.</p>
<p>He said, in the year 1916, when the first world war raged, a doctor from Canada who is also a poet named John McCrae, saw poppies growing in the middle of the battlefield.</p>
<p>Poppy Flower is made he was moved to write a poem titled War in Flanders, a place in Belgium where the battle took place.</p>
<p>Since then, Poppy is initially only known as opium poppies and drug plants, became a symbol of eternity in the hearts of the heroes of English society.</p>
